Honoring Love & Legacy
Our Memorial Funds
At Plymouth Helping Hands for Animals, we believe that every pet deserves love, care, and the opportunity to live a happy, healthy life. Our Memorial Funds are a heartfelt tribute to the cherished animals and compassionate individuals who have left a lasting impact on our community.
These special funds provide lifesaving veterinary care for pets in need and help keep our Pet Food Pantries stocked, ensuring that no pet goes hungry and every animal gets the support they deserve. Through these funds, we honor the memory of beloved pets and animal lovers while continuing their legacy of kindness.
Jim Miller Fund For Critical Care
The Jim Miller Fund was created in memory of Jim Miller, a beloved Plymouth pet owner whose heart was as big as his love for animals. This incredible fund was made possible by a generous personal donation from Jim’s partner, Diane Walsh, a dedicated volunteer with Helping Hands.
Thanks to Diane’s heartfelt contribution, we were able to kickstart this fund with the goal of saving pets in desperate need of critical care. We’re fully committed to growing this fund and ensuring that no pet is left behind due to costly medical treatments.
Let’s honor Jim’s legacy by coming together to save lives and keep pets healthy when they need it most!

Wayne Botelho Memorial Fund
The Wayne Botelho Memorial Fund was created in loving memory of Wayne Botelho. His amazing family and friends have come together to honor his spirit by supporting the mission of Plymouth Helping Hands for Animals, with a special focus on our Pet Food Pantry at the Plymouth Center for Active Living (CAL).
Wayne’s legacy of love and generosity will continue to impact local pets and families in need, helping to ensure that no pet goes hungry. His memory lives on in every act of kindness we’re able to offer, thanks to his loved ones’ support.

Jane Pimental Memorial Fund
Jane was a true Plymouthian, born and raised right here in our community. A lifelong animal lover, Jane’s heart belonged especially to her beloved cats, and she was also a cherished patron of the Center for Active Living (CAL).
When Jane passed away in 2022, her family reached out to us with an incredibly thoughtful and heartfelt request—to create a memorial legacy fund in her name to support the Pet Food Pantry at the CAL. We were honored to help make this tribute a reality, and we couldn’t be more excited to keep her love for animals alive through this meaningful gesture.
This fund is a beautiful way to celebrate Jane’s life and continue her compassionate legacy, ensuring that pets in need will always have food and care. Thank you to Jane’s family for allowing us to be part of such a special and loving tribute!
